I had the opportunity to go yesterday when it opened. Lots and lots of people. So much amazing stuff in there, too. I knew it'd be both Monogatari and Madoka-centric, but I kind of hoped for their other works to have some spotlight as well, but outside of some character designs and some opening animation sequences there wasn't much.

The final hall had all of endcard artworks featured in the shows, though. It was incredible to look at them all together, from Arakawa's to Zetsubou-sensei's, going through Hidamari Sketch, Maria Holic and Pani Poni Dash.

All in all, it was definitely well-worth the price. Also snatched the exhibition's book at the gift shop, though I'm saddened the new straps were sold-out by the time I got there.
